APPLICATION OF PARAMETRIC SURFACE REPRESENTATION TO EVALUATING FORM FACTORS AND LIKE QUANTITIES
SINOPSIS
Mathematical software packages like Mathcad and Mathematica have now reached the point where they can be routinely used to evaluate multiple integrals like the ones that arise in form factor evaluation, and this provides a new mechanism for form factor evaluation. On the other hand, before starting such numerical evaluation one must first construct the definite integral, and this is not always straightforward. The present paper demonstrates how representing the surfaces parametrically simplifies the construction of the integral and provides the basis for a standardized procedure. The paper gives a catalogue of parametric representations of some typical surfaces in arbitrary orientations and locations, and demonstrates the use of the catalogue on some sample problems.
